ADF4158WCCPZ-RL7 Overview
As a clock IC, PLLs is packaged using the Tape & Reel (TR) method. This clock generator is embedded in the 24-WFQFN Exposed Pad, CSP package. Under reflowing process, this clock generator ic is able to sustain a maximum temperature of NOT SPECIFIED. 24 terminations can be found in frequency synthesizer. Basically, a voltage of 3V should be applied to this electronic frequency generator. CMOS, TTL is designed as this clock generator's input. 1 circuits are implemented to access the electronic component's full performance. This clock-based frequency generator provides a frequency up to 6.1GHz Max. This component can be conveniently installed on the panel thanks to the Surface Mount. Clock PLL works with 2.7V~3.3V supply voltage provided. The ambient temperature should be set at -40°C~125°C, which is estimated by the test statistics. This is a clock generator compatible with Clock logic levels. This electronic component can be classified as a Fractional N Synthesizer (RF). This clock-generating IC is a 24-bit device designed explicitly for microprocessors. According to the base part number ADF4158, its related parts can be found. There is an available 24 pin on the clock generators. And basically, this clock generator is often classified as a kind of PLL or Frequency Synthesis Circuits. This electronic part is a member of the Automotive series. A supply current of 23mA needs to be provided to fully play RF synthesizer's function. The maximum supply current for this electronic frequency generator should not be in excess of 32mA.
